摘要
目的探讨糖尿病视网膜病变(DR)与免疫球蛋白G (IgG)N-糖基化的相关性,为疾病的发生发展提供依据。方法将纳入的2型糖尿病患者以是否患有DR分为病例组和对照组,比较两组IgG N-糖基化水平,通过二分类logistic模型校正其他协变量。结果直接测量的糖基峰中,GP4、GP6、GP17和GP19在病例组水平较高,而GP15、GP16、GP18和GP21在对照组含量较高(P<0.05);在校正年龄、性别等其他协变量后,代表唾液酸化的10种衍生结构差异均有统计学意义(P<0.05)。结论 IgG N-糖基化的唾液酸化与DR的发生发展有相关性。
Objective To explore the association between diabetic retinopathy(DR)and immunoglobulin G(IgG)N-glycosylation,and to provide basis for disease control. Methods Type 2 diabetes mellitus(T2 DM)patients were divided into case group(with DR)and control group(without DR).The levels of IgG N-glycosylation were compared between two groups and the other covariates were adjusted by dichotomous logistic model. Results Among the directed measured glycans,the levels of GP4,GP6,GP17 and GP19 were higher in case group,while the levels of GP15,GP16,GP18 and GP21 were higher in control group(P<0.05).After adjusting for other covariates by age and gender,the differences of ten derived glycans representing sialylation were significant(P<0.05). Conclusions There is a positive correlation between IgG N-glycosylated sialylation and the development of DR.
